Understanding Specification Table Merges
Specification Table Merge Workbench runs the batch applications that merge custom modifications into the new specification tables. It then updates the Table Conversion Scheduler table (F98405) to indicate completion, and writes a conversion log record. The Object Librarian and Versions List merges are now a part of the specification merge.
For all users, the Specification Merge merges data in the following order:
Object Librarian
Versions
Specifications
For users installing an alternate language, the Specification Merge Workbench merges the central objects and language text from the previous release into the new central objects database.
The central objects tables contain the alternate language records needed for displaying text in the selected language. Language-enabled tables include the Processing Option Text table (F98306), the Report Design Aid Text Information table (F98760), and the Forms Design Aid Text Information table (F98750). Depending on the environment choices made during the English installation, you might have several sets of central objects; for example, one set for each environment loaded during the English-language installation.
